当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

源码如何上传到服务器,详细教程,如何将源码上传至云服务器,实现高效部署

源码如何上传到服务器,详细教程,如何将源码上传至云服务器,实现高效部署

将源码上传至云服务器实现高效部署,可遵循以下步骤:配置本地开发环境,确保代码可正常运行。选择合适的云服务提供商,如阿里云、腾讯云等,并创建云服务器实例。通过SSH或FT...

将源码上传至云服务器实现高效部署,可遵循以下步骤:配置本地开发环境,确保代码可正常运行。选择合适的云服务提供商,如阿里云、腾讯云等,并创建云服务器实例。通过SSH或FTP等工具将源码压缩并上传至服务器。解压源码,配置服务器环境,运行部署脚本,完成源码部署。

随着互联网技术的不断发展,越来越多的企业选择将业务迁移到云端,在这个过程中,如何将源码上传至云服务器,实现高效部署,成为了许多开发者关注的问题,本文将详细介绍如何将源码上传至云服务器,并提供一些建议,帮助大家顺利实现源码的迁移与部署。

源码如何上传到服务器,详细教程,如何将源码上传至云服务器,实现高效部署

准备工作

1、云服务器:你需要拥有一台云服务器,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等,你可以根据自己的需求选择合适的云服务器。

2、SSH密钥:为了方便远程登录服务器,你需要生成一对SSH密钥(公钥和私钥),并将公钥添加到服务器的SSH授权文件中。

3、源码:确保你的源码已经准备好,并且已经进行版本控制(如使用Git)。

源码上传至云服务器

1、使用SSH密钥登录服务器

在本地计算机上,使用SSH客户端(如PuTTY、Xshell等)连接到云服务器,在连接过程中,选择使用SSH密钥进行认证,并输入私钥的路径

2、创建项目目录

登录服务器后,使用以下命令创建项目目录:

mkdir /home/your_username/your_project
cd /home/your_username/your_project

3、克隆源码

使用Git克隆源码到服务器:

源码如何上传到服务器,详细教程,如何将源码上传至云服务器,实现高效部署

git clone https://your_repository/your_project.git

4、修改配置文件

根据项目需求,修改服务器上的配置文件,如数据库连接、日志路径等。

5、安装依赖

根据项目需求,安装所需的依赖库,使用pip安装Python项目依赖:

pip install -r requirements.txt

6、部署项目

根据项目类型(如Web、后端等),选择合适的部署方法,以下列举几种常见的部署方法:

(1)使用虚拟环境

对于Python项目,可以使用virtualenv创建虚拟环境,并安装依赖:

virtualenv venv
source venv/bin/activate
pip install -r requirements.txt

(2)使用容器化技术

源码如何上传到服务器,详细教程,如何将源码上传至云服务器,实现高效部署

使用Docker等技术进行容器化部署,可以简化部署过程,以下是一个简单的Dockerfile示例:

FROM python:3.7
RUN pip install -r requirements.txt
CMD ["python", "your_script.py"]

(3)使用自动化部署工具

使用Jenkins、Ansible等自动化部署工具,可以实现对项目的自动化部署。

注意事项

1、优化网络连接:在源码上传过程中,确保网络连接稳定,避免因网络问题导致上传失败。

2、使用版本控制:使用Git等版本控制工具,方便源码的管理和备份。

3、服务器安全:定期更新服务器软件,关闭不必要的端口,确保服务器安全。

4、监控与日志:监控服务器运行状态,记录日志信息,以便在出现问题时快速定位问题原因。

本文详细介绍了如何将源码上传至云服务器,并实现高效部署,通过掌握这些方法,你可以轻松地将项目迁移到云端,享受云计算带来的便利,在实际操作过程中,请根据项目需求选择合适的部署方法,并注意服务器安全,祝你在云计算领域取得成功!

黑狐家游戏

发表评论

最新文章